Swiss tennis star and world No 2, Roger Federer has just won his sixth Australian Open title, including becoming the first man to win an astonishing 20 Grand Slam title.
The 36-year-old defeated his opponent Croatia's Marin Cilic in five sets 6-2, 6-7, 6-3, 3-6, 6-1 in three hours and three minutes to achieve the milestone in Melbourne this afternoon.
Federer has now drawn level with world No. 14 Novak Djokovic on six Australian titles.
He is also the first man and fourth person in history to hit the twenties in Major singles titles, joining women tennis stars Margaret Court, Serena Williams and Steffi Graf.
